In the morning, visit the historic Mattancherry Palace that showcases Kerala-style architecture. Afternoon, explore the Paradesi Synagogue and the Jew Town market. In the evening, enjoy a sunset cruise along the Cochin Harbour.
Start your day with a visit to the Echo Point, known for its natural echo phenomenon. In the afternoon, head to the famous Tata Tea Museum to learn about Munnar's tea culture. In the evening, enjoy a walk in the serene surroundings of the Tea Gardens.
Begin the day with a boat ride in the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ary, where you have a chance to spot elephants and other wildlife. In the afternoon, visit the Spice Plantation for a guided tour and enjoy traditional Kerala food. In the evening, witness a Kathakali performance, a traditional dance-drama of Kerala.
Take a morning houseboat cruise through the backwaters of Kumarakom. In the afternoon, visit the Kumarakom Bird Sanctuary, home to a variety of migratory birds. In the evening, relax and enjoy a traditional Ayurvedic massage.
Start the day with a visit to the Kovalam Lighthouse Beach, where you can enjoy water sports and relax on the beach. In the afternoon, visit the Halcyon Castle and the nearby Vizhinjam Fishing Harbour. In the evening, enjoy a seafood dinner at a beachside restaurant.
Begin the day with a visit to the Padmanabhaswamy Temple, a famous Hindu temple known for its intricate architecture. In the afternoon, visit the Napier Museum and the adjacent Zoological Gardens. In the evening, shop for souvenirs at the local markets before departing.
